Can Cats Eat Fabric Softener . While detergents are commonly used in the household, some can cause corrosive injury, particularly to cats. Spilled detergents should be promptly cleaned up; Used sheets have minimal amounts of detergent. Fabric softeners contain cationic detergents. Never try to induce vomiting—this may increase the irritation to the esophagus and mouth. Oral ulcers can develop if a pet chews on a new, unused dryer sheet. Exposure to cats typically occurs when cats walk through spilled liquid detergent, only to be groomed and orally ingested thereafter. If you think that your cat ate a dryer sheet or drank some liquid fabric softener, it is essential to contact your veterinarian immediately. Fabric softeners, sanitizers, disinfectants, rust inhibitors in petroleum products and quaternary ammoniums are all cationic detergents. Fabric softeners, both in liquid and dryer sheet form, can be very dangerous for your cat to ingest. Find out how to prevent this and what to. These clinical signs do require treatment by a veterinarian. These detergents have the potential to cause significant signs like drooling, vomiting, oral and esophageal ulcers and fever.
